Auto-saving and synchronization: Losing hours of hard work is always frustrating, so that's why Google Sheets automatically saves your modifications.As you have access to many different types of charts, you can effortlessly view data in different ways depending on the scenario. Charts: You can turn your complex data processes into meaningful and comprehensive information using charts.Multiple sheets: You can use data across sheets of the same spreadsheet but also across spreadsheets so that everything is where it belongs and your work stays organized.Also, you can quickly process and store all the pieces of data you need, use built-in formulas and conditional formatting to add consistency, pivot tables, graphic tools, and lots more. The editor: Thanks to the Google Sheet editor, you can handle and manipulate simple to very complicated spreadsheets.What are the key features of Google Sheets? Simply put, it offers a reliable, versatile, secure, and powerful environment to automate spreadsheet data processing. ![]() Google Sheets is a spreadsheet solution part of the Google Suite that allows you to handle and process all the data you want in one or several spreadsheets. ![]()
